Output 04029086254c0a65cf7c9153063281cb99b9ccaee0961d13b12cb5424680d186:1

value
149320437
script pubkey
OP_0 OP_PUSHBYTES_20 e40c4ae9734801f28245185dbf76cad8a4867ec6
address
ltc1qusxy46tnfqql9qj9rpwm7ak2mzjgvlkxga79p0
transaction
04029086254c0a65cf7c9153063281cb99b9ccaee0961d13b12cb5424680d186
spent
true